Lupasol® WF is a highly versatile polyethyleneimine that has found extensive use in several industries. It is commonly used as an adhesion promoter in adhesives and car tires and for the complexation of heavy metal ions. Besides, it is also used in printing ink and plastic modification, as well as pigment manufacture. It can even immobilize proteins in inorganic materials. Other applications of Lupasol® SK include antistripping agents, emulsifiers, surface modifiers, and binders, as well as dispersants. It is also employed as a building block for polycarboxylate ether (PCE).
